The cornerstone of the Costco massage chair return policy is the standard satisfaction guarantee period. For most electronics and major appliances, this window is typically 90 days from the date of purchase. During this time, you can return the item for a full refund if it does not meet your needs or expectations. This generous timeframe allows you to thoroughly test the chair in your home environment, assessing its effectiveness for your specific pain points and lifestyle. It is long enough to break in the equipment and learn all its features, yet provides a clear cutoff for buyer’s remorse.

Exceptions to the 90-Day Rule

While the 90-day policy applies to many models, it is important to verify the exact terms for the specific chair you are considering. Certain premium models or special order items may be subject to different conditions, sometimes extending the return period or requiring additional documentation. Always review the sales receipt or the product page details, as these documents contain the binding agreement. If you are purchasing a display model, for example, the policy regarding opening the box or accepting minor cosmetic flaws might differ from a brand-new unit sealed in the warehouse.

Condition Requirements for a Successful Return

To qualify for a refund, the massage chair must be returned in the same condition as it was received. This means the original packaging, including the box, foam, and plastic wrapping, should be kept in the best possible shape. Costco requires that the item be clean and free of any damage not attributable to normal use. If the packaging is damaged or missing, you may still be able to return the item, but it is best to contact customer service in advance to explain the situation and get approval.

The Role of Delivery and Assembly

Because massage chairs are bulky and heavy, delivery is a critical part of the ownership experience and the return process. If you decide to return the chair, you will generally be responsible for arranging the return shipment or scheduling a pickup, depending on the options provided at the time of purchase. The original delivery team often has the authority to facilitate reverse logistics. Be aware that if the chair was assembled by Costco installation services, you might need to disassemble it to its original parts before the return, or you may be charged a fee for the take-back service.

Alternative Options: Exchange or Adjustment

If the issue with the massage chair is not a deal-breaker but rather a matter of preference, consider an exchange rather than a return. Perhaps the intensity of the rollers is too aggressive, or the lumbar support feels insufficient. Within the return window, you may be able to exchange the unit for a different model that better suits your physical needs. This option is often preferable to a full refund, as it allows you to find the right fit without losing your investment in wellness technology entirely.

Practical Steps Before You Buy

Avoiding the hassle of a return starts long before the chair arrives at your door. The most effective strategy is to utilize the in-store experience available at Costco warehouses. Spend time actually sitting in the chairs on the floor, testing the programs, and simulating the zero-gravity position. Take notes on the comfort level and the noise output. If the model you want is not available for test drives, research online reviews and videos to simulate the experience. This due diligence ensures that your return is based on genuine incompatibility rather than a misunderstanding of the product's capabilities.
